About Bolton Lodge and Proctor House
Set in Bolton Le Sands on Morecambe Bay, Bolton Lodge is a grade two listed building built in 1980 with nine rooms, offering sheltered housing for older people.

Frequently Asked Questions about Bolton Lodge and Proctor House
How much does living at Abbeyfield cost?
From £1,350 per month. Please contact the house directly for more information.
How do I apply to become a resident?
Once you've found a home you'd like to move into, you can get in touch directly with the house. Please email or call to arrange a visit and find out more information.
Can I bring my car with me?
We have parking available, so you can bring your car with you and drive around the local area at your own pace.
Can my friends and family stay overnight?
We have guest facilities available for your friends, family and loved ones to stay if they wish.
Can my family visit?
Yes – family and friends are welcome to visit you whenever suits, after all, this is your home.
Are meals provided?
We provide lunch and dinner daily. We have a three week rolling menu which is changed seasonally.
What activities are there for residents?
We hold coffee mornings every day which are very much enjoyed by our residents and organise trips throughout the year. We have garden parties in the summer for the local community to attend and plenty of events, themed activities and wonderful food at Christmas time.
What will my accommodation be like?
Set in Bolton Le Sands on Morcambe Bay, we have two beautiful buildings; Bolton Lodge which is a grade two listed building built in 1980 with nine rooms, and Procter House which is a converted barn consisting of five flats.
What's in the local area?
Morecambe Bay is a beautiful place, known for its stunning sunsets and natural landscapes. The Lancaster Canal runs through the town just 200 yards from the house. There are good transport links to nearby Lancaster, Morecambe and Carnforth. The local library is across the road from the house and churches are within walking distance. We have a local butcher, greengrocer and many convenience stores nearby and we are very fortunate to be close to an award winning fish and chip shop.
What age do I need to be to live in an Abbeyfield retirement home?
We welcome any person aged 55 years and over to live at Abbeyfield - whether you want to downsize, simply want to live in companionship with others, or no longer feel able to continue living in your own home.
